Wheel balance
Tyres that are out of balance will cause a vehicle to vibrate at higher speeds (usually around 50–70mph). … Out-of-balance tyres can cause vibration in the steering wheel, through the seat, and through the floor (steering wheel – front tyres; seat/floor – back tyres).
If your tires are out of alignment or out of balance, they may send shakes through your vehicle and to the steering wheel. … Shaking from tires that are out of balance is likely to start when you’re going around 50 miles per hour or faster, though it may start to become less noticeable again at higher speeds.
The shaking is typical of a tire that is out of balance. Tires are balanced with metal weights. Over time, weights can come off. The other possible problem is that one of the tires is damaged and has a cord separation, which could cause the vibration and lead to a tire blowout.

No. Worn out shocks/struts will not cause a vibration, they will cause the car to “float” because they are no longer damping the low-frequency oscillations of the coil springs. The entire car will be more “bouncy”, but they will not cause a vibration in the steering.

When your tie rods go bad, the symptom you’re most likely to experience first is a vibration or shaking sensation in your steering wheel. You may also hear associated clunking and rattling noises, especially when turning the vehicle at low speeds. These sounds are caused by tie rods that are starting to wear out.

Often, a bad CV axle will make a clicking noise when steering the car left or right. A bad bearing makes an intermittent roaring noise, until it fails catastrophically. CV joints clunk or make louder noises on tight turns. Wheel bearings get louder with speed.
Bad cv joints can cause the ticking sound. Bad front wheel bearing can cause wobble. … Possibly bad wheel bearing, cv joint, ball joint or tie rod end. If there is excessive movement when shaking tire inspect for which part is loose causing this.

To help confirm that the vehicle has an engine speed related vibration, with the vehicle stopped, put it into park or neutral and raise the engine speed to the RPM at which the vibration occurred to see if the vibration can be reproduced. If reproduced, diagnosis should begin with engine speed related components.
When driving on loose surfaces, such as on dirt, gravel or snow, the wheels will slip slightly to allow for any difference in front-torear axle speed. However, if 4WD is locked when driving on a dry, paved road, the wheels will grip and cause the front and rear axles to bind up. This can feel like a vibration.
The common symptoms of out-of-balance tires are uneven and faster tread wear, poor fuel economy, and vibration in the steering wheel, the floorboard or the seat that gets worse at faster speeds. When all areas of the wheel-tire unit are as equal in weight as possible, the tire will roll smoothly.

Wheel and tire problems
The most prevalent cause of vibration is problems with your wheels or tires. The potential problems include improper wheel and tire balance, uneven tire wear, separated tire tread, out of round tires, damaged wheels and even loose lug nuts.
